Description
Key Features
Analyzes three major twenty-first century novels by Richard Powers, Dave Eggers, and Don DeLillo to identify trends in US fiction.
Examines the impact of biotechnology, digital technologies, and cryonics on the human condition through literary analysis.
Provides a dual perspective by comparing optimistic transhumanist philosophy with the balanced views of critical posthumanism.
Investigates the narrative strategies writers use to explore the possibilities and warnings of technological augmentation.
Offers scholarly insight into the evolving relationship between humanity and non-human technological advancements.
